Saturday, August 22, 2020

Programming Languages Essay

The approach of the cutting edge time offered ascend to the development of the significance of PCs and innovation to the lives of the people. The simplicity with which utilizing PCs is related has pulled in clients to additionally improve the manner in which PCs can more readily serve people. One of the manners in which that PC was improved was through programming dialects. Programming dialects was created and was additionally improved. A programming language is characterized as a counterfeit language basic recorded as a hard copy guidelines (â€Å"Programming Language†) and PC programs in a progression of directions that people can comprehend and compilers and linkers can peruse. This program is then converted into a machine code that the PC can comprehend and run (Bolton). Programming dialects didn't come simple, as its first creations were hard to work. During the 1940s, PC programs expected software engineers to compose the groupings of digits that the PC performed. It was troublesome as well as was bound to mistakes. Software engineers should compose memory areas. This was impractical consistently when there are mistakes (â€Å"Programming Language†). This end up being wasteful and moderate. Before long codes were created to address these issues (Bolton). A portion of the programming dialects utilized at that point are Fortran, Cobol, and Basic. These were the programming dialects that were utilized during the 1960s and the 1970s (Bolton). Fortran, which stands the for Formula Translation, was the main language to be created by IBM during the late 1950s. This language offers significance to the proficiency of arrangement and execution. Cobol, then again, was created during the 1960s as a business application language for smaller than expected and centralized server programming (â€Å"Cobol†). Another programming language that was created in 1960s that was utilized for microcomputer programming reasons for existing is BASIC (â€Å"Programming Language†). It represents Beginner’s All-reason Symbolic Instruction Code. Essential was created to be an option for Fortran (Smillie). Today, the broadly utilized programming dialects are C, C++, and Java. The C programming language was created in 1970s at the Bell Telephone Laboratories for the Operating Systems (Bolton), and was utilized for business applications (â€Å"Programming Language†). It was grown basically as a frameworks language for the UNIX condition (Smillie). Today is as yet utilized on Unix and Linux frameworks (Bolton). The C++ programming language, then again, was created in 1980s at AT&T Bell Laboratories (â€Å"Programming Language†) and is the most seasoned among the three (Akhverdyan). Its engineers believed it to be a superset of C, and both were utilized for the early on registering courses (Smillie). The basic role for building up the language was adding Object Oriented Programming to C (Bolton). The PC programming industry jumped at the chance to utilize C++ in light of the fact that it permits the portion of memory and erasing it at whatever point the client needs. In addition, C++ contains the highlights that Java offers, and it permits the client to make the program in a â€Å"object situated manner† (Akhverdyan). Java was created by Sun, basically intended to compose programs for PC contributes electronic apparatuses. Later on, Java was found to be perfect for structuring and executing programs for the Internet (Smillie). It is simpler to utilize on the grounds that its orders are English based, and not in numeric codes. Further, people can without much of a stretch peruse and write in Java (Leahy). It is better than the recently referenced programming dialects since it has an applet, a component that lone Java has. Applets are utilized in the World Wide Web. Another element of Java is that it is cross-stage, which implies that the code written in Windows can be assembled in other working frameworks (Bolton). Different attributes of Java are its convenience, security, unwavering quality and stage autonomy (Leahy). Works Cited Akhverdyan, Hamik. 2009 January 5. Step by step instructions to Choose the Right Programming Language. Related Content. 12 January 2009 <http://www. associatedcontent. com/article/1332397/how_to_choose_the_right_programming. html? cat=15>. Bolton, David. 2009. What is a Programming Language? Related Content. 12 January 2009 <http://www. associatedcontent. com/article/1332397/how_to_choose_the_right_programming. html? page=2&cat=15>. â€Å"Cobol. † 2008. Answers. com. 12 January 2009 <http://www. answers. com/subject/cobol-technology>. Leahy, Paul. 2009. What is Java? About. com. 12 January 2009 <http://java. about. com/od/gettingstarted/a/whatisjava. htm>. â€Å"Programming Language. † 2008. Answers. com. 12 January 2009 <http://www. answers. com/point/programming-language>. Smillie, Keith. 2006. â€Å"Programming Then and Now: From the LGP-30 to the PC. † 12 January 2009 <http://www. cs. ualberta. ca/~smillie/ProgLang/ProgThenAndNow. pdf>.

Friday, August 21, 2020

Merits and Demerits of Globalisation Essay

Presentation Globalization or (globalization) is the procedure by which the individuals of the world are bound together into a solitary society and capacity together. Globalization is frequently used to allude to monetary globalization: the combination of national economies into the universal economy through exchange, outside direct venture, capital streams, relocation, and the spread of innovation. This procedure is generally perceived as being driven by a blend of monetary, mechanical, socio-social, political and natural variables. The term can likewise allude to the transnational scattering of thoughts, dialects, or mainstream society. Globalization implies expanding the relationship, network and incorporation on a worldwide level regarding the social, social, political, mechanical, monetary and natural levels. Impacts of globalization:- ? upgrade in the data stream between topographically remote areas ? the worldwide regular market has an opportunity of trade of products and capital ? there is a wide access to a scope of products for buyers and organizations ? overall creation markets develop ? Organizations have more noteworthy adaptability to work across outskirts ? Expanded progression of interchanges permits essential data to be shared among people and enterprises the world over ? Spread of vote based standards to created countries ? More noteworthy relationship of country states ? Decrease of probability of war between created countries ? Laborers in less created nations should see an expansion in wages and living advantages. On the off chance that they do, their rising way of life should assist them with expending items from created countries. A prudent circle can hypothetically be made by a totally different working class that didn’t exist. ? Harmony ought to be simpler to keep up between countries as no nation would stay separated in this new world request. The relationship of China and the United States has changed drastically as their exchange accomplice status has expanded throughout the years. ? Globalization can help modernize creating nations quicker. Present day thoughts can be spread to the laborers, who make up the social request. ? Items can be bought a lot less expensive in creating nations, which builds the way of life of the individuals. As we save money on straightforward normal things, we have more to spend on expensive things, which fuel more generously compensated assembling employments in created nations. Points of interest of globalization in the creating scene It is guaranteed that globalization builds the financial flourishing and opportunity in the creating scene. The common freedoms are improved and there is a progressively effective utilization of assets. All the nations associated with the unhindered commerce are at a benefit. Therefore, there are lower costs, greater work and a superior standard of life in these creating countries. It is expected that some creating districts progress to the detriment of other created locales. Notwithstanding, such questions are worthless as globalization is a positive-whole possibility wherein the abilities and advancements empower to expand the expectations for everyday comforts all through the world. Nonconformists take a gander at globalization as a productive device to dispose of penury and permit the destitute individuals a firm toehold in the worldwide economy. In two decades from 1981 to 2001, the quantity of individuals getting by on $1 or less every day diminished from 1. 5 billion to 1. 1 billion. All the while, the total populace additionally expanded. Along these lines, the level of such individuals diminished from 40% to 20% in such creating nations. Inconveniences of globalization Disadvantages of globalization are as per the following:- ? Expanded progression of talented and non-gifted employments from created to creating countries as companies search out the least expensive work ? Improved probability of financial disturbances in a single country affecting all countries ? Corporate impact of country states far surpasses that of common society associations and normal people ? Danger that control of world media by a bunch of companies will restrict social articulation ?